Description
The Kseibi Garden Trowel is built for everyday planting, potting and light digging jobs around the garden. Its forged steel construction gives the tool a solid, dependable feel in the hand, while the black powder-coated surface finish adds a clean, durable outer layer. The blade shape shown is well suited to moving soil, opening planting holes and working neatly around roots in beds, borders and containers.
A two-colour orange and black plastic handle with black TPR grip is designed to make the trowel comfortable to hold and easier to control during repeated use. The shaped handle and neck help you guide the blade accurately when transplanting seedlings, filling pots or tidying up compact spaces. At 325 mm long, it offers a practical balance of reach and maneuverability for close garden work.
This is a straightforward hand tool for gardeners who want reliable materials and a comfortable grip without unnecessary bulk. It is supplied in hanging card packing, making it easy to display, store or present as part of a gardening kit.
